有一些 SaaS 提供商会做这种事情,但我不想依赖第三方。我正在寻找一个(最好是开源的)本地托管的 UNIX 命令行库来接收数百种不同的文档格式(doc、docx、csv、xls、txt、tiff 等),并将它们转换为 PDF。所以:
- 是否有一个简单、统一的图书馆可以做到这一点,还是我需要处理一大堆图书馆?
- 哪些图书馆/图书馆可以完成这项工作?
如果有可用的付费图书馆,我也有兴趣了解它们。但开源是首选路线。
有一些 SaaS 提供商会做这种事情,但我不想依赖第三方。我正在寻找一个(最好是开源的)本地托管的 UNIX 命令行库来接收数百种不同的文档格式(doc、docx、csv、xls、txt、tiff 等),并将它们转换为 PDF。所以:
如果有可用的付费图书馆,我也有兴趣了解它们。但开源是首选路线。
最成熟的开源是 OpenOffice,它可以“无头”(无 UI)运行,如下所述:
http://code.google.com/p/openmeetings/wiki/OpenOfficeConverter
您可以使用 OpenOffice 的 Apache.org 分支,据报道它比 LibreOffice 更快,并且具有更宽松的许可证。